c语言连接数据库

更新时间:02-09 教程 由 蓝玉 分享

C语言连接数据库(详解如何在C语言中实现数据库连接)

随着信息化的发展,越来越多的应用程序需要使用数据库来存储数据。而C语言作为一种广泛应用于系统编程的语言,也需要能够连接数据库来满足应用的需求。本文将详细介绍如何在C语言中实现数据库连接。

二、数据库连接的基本原理

nectivity,开放数据库连接)来实现数据库连接。

ODBC是一个标准的PI,它定义了一套通用的接口,使得开发人员可以使用统一的方式来连接不同类型的数据库。ODBC需要使用驱动程序来实现与具体数据库的通信,不同类型的数据库需要使用不同的驱动程序。

三、连接数据库的步骤

1. 安装ODBC驱动程序

在连接数据库之前,需要先安装ODBC驱动程序。不同类型的数据库需要使用不同的ODBC驱动程序,可以在官方网站上下载并安装。

2. 编写连接数据库的代码

连接数据库的代码需要使用ODBC PI,具体步骤如下

(1)加载ODBC驱动程序

dlenect来连接数据库,示例代码如下

```v;

SLHDBC dbc;t;

SLRETURN ret;

dlev);vttrv, SL_TTR_ODBC_VERSION, (void)SL_OV_ODBC3, 0);dlev, &dbc);nect(dbc, (SLCHR)"DSN=MySL", SL_NTS, 0, SL_DRIVER_COMPLETE);dlet);

其中,第四个参数“DSN=MySL”是ODBC数据源名称,需要根据实际情况修改。

(2)执行SL语句

连接成功后,就可以执行SL语句了。使用函数SLPrepare来准备SL语句,然后使用函数SLExecute来执行SL语句,示例代码如下

```ts"; = SL_NTS;

t);t);

(3)获取结果集

执行SL语句后,可以通过函数SLFetch来获取结果集中的一行数据,示例代码如下

```t) == SL_SUCCESS) {

// 处理结果集中的数据

(4)关闭连接

nectdle来关闭连接,示例代码如下

```nect(dbc);dle(SL_HNDLE_DBC, dbc);dlev);

本文详细介绍了如何在C语言中实现数据库连接,包括安装ODBC驱动程序、编写连接数据库的代码等步骤。通过本文的介绍,相信读者已经掌握了连接数据库的基本原理和步骤,可以在实际应用中灵活运用。

声明:关于《c语言连接数据库》以上内容仅供参考,若您的权利被侵害,请联系13825271@qq.com
本文网址:http://www.25820.com/tutorial/14_2102273.html